In most cases, the LCD displays in projectors are not interchangeable. Each projector model is designed with a specific LCD display panel that is optimized for that models specifications. Even within the same brand and model, there may be slight variations in the LCD panel, making it difficult to use a different LCD panel as a replacement. It is always recommended to use manufacturer-approved replacement parts to ensure the best performance and compatibility.

Firstly, it is important to understand that not all projectors use LCD displays. Some use Digital Light Processing (DLP) technology, which operates using tiny mirrors that reflect light. However, for the purpose of this article, we will focus on projectors that use LCD displays.

LCD displays are used in projectors to create an image by manipulating light. An LCD panel consists of a layer of liquid crystals sandwiched between two polarized glass filters. An electrical current is applied to the crystals, which makes them twist and change the way light passes through them. As a result, different colors are created, and an image is displayed on the screen.

Now, coming to the question of whether LCD displays in projectors are interchangeable, the answer is not straightforward. While it may be theoretically possible to replace an LCD display from one projector model to another, it is not recommended.

This is because the LCD panel is not the only part that determines the projectors image quality. Other components, including the optics and electronics, also play a vital role. Even if the replacement LCD display has the same specifications as the original one, it may not work as well as the original one. This can result in a compromised image quality, color accuracy, and other issues.

Moreover, it is worth noting that different projector models may have different-sized LCD panels or use different connectors. Therefore, replacing an LCD display requires careful consideration of various factors, including compatibility, cost-effectiveness, and performance.
